Patrick Hevron

Patrick John Hevron (12 May 1867-1930) was born in North Fremantle, son of Denis William and Catherine Hevron (nee Kernon). Patrick married Silda Ann Matison (1871-1962) on 30.10.1894 in Fremantle. He was apprenticed to Pearse Brothers in the leather trade and later established his own business as a customs and forwarding agent. He was a Councillor at North Fremantle 1897, 1900* and Mayor 1904-1905. Patrick Hevron was the Foundation President of the Fremantle Trotting Club 1927-1930. Photograph Fremantle Library Local History Collection text and 1900 photo #3811.

  • The library entry has 1897-1920, but its spreadsheet of North Freo reps has 1897 and 1900. I'm guessing that the latter is more likely, and the first is a typo.
